Definition and Explanation of Queenright
In beekeeping, queenright refers to a colony that has a well-established and thriving queen bee. This means that the queen is laying eggs regularly, ensuring the growth and development of the colony. A queenright colony is crucial for the overall health and productivity of the bees.
When a colony is queenless or struggling with an underperforming queen, it can lead to issues such as reduced honey production, poor brood patterns, and increased susceptibility to pests and diseases. On the other hand, a queenright colony is more resilient and better equipped to handle challenges. This is because the presence of a strong and healthy queen enables the bees to work together efficiently, maintain their hive’s cleanliness, and store ample food reserves.
To achieve and maintain a queenright status, beekeepers must carefully select suitable queens for their colonies and ensure they are introduced at the right time. Regular monitoring of the queen’s performance is also essential, allowing beekeepers to intervene promptly if issues arise.

Identifying Signs of a Good or Bad Queenright
A healthy queenright is crucial for a thriving beehive. To determine whether your queen is providing good quality eggs, look for signs such as consistent brood production and a steady increase in hive population. A good queen will typically lay around 1,500-2,000 eggs per day during peak season.
On the other hand, if you notice a decrease in brood production or an overall decline in hive population, it may indicate a problem with the queenright. Some common signs of a bad queen include irregular egg-laying patterns, deformed or aborted brood, and reduced worker bee longevity.
To identify these issues, inspect your brood nest regularly and count the number of eggs laid per day. Monitor the overall health and behavior of your bees, including their activity levels, foraging efficiency, and communication with each other through pheromones. If you notice any irregularities or concerns, consider replacing your queen to ensure the long-term success of your beehive. Regular monitoring will help you detect potential problems early on and make informed decisions about your queen’s quality.

Genetics and Breeding Programs
When it comes to queenright quality, genetics and breeding programs play a significant role. The selection of desirable traits such as honey production, disease resistance, and temperament is crucial for producing high-quality queens. Beekeepers often look for breeders who have implemented genetic testing and selective breeding programs to improve the overall health and productivity of their queens.
These programs involve evaluating individual queens or colonies based on specific characteristics and then using that data to make informed breeding decisions. For example, a breeder may choose to prioritize queens with high honey production potential by selecting for traits such as increased brood size and improved nectar collection behavior. Similarly, breeders may focus on disease resistance by selecting for queens with enhanced immune systems or those that have shown resilience in the face of common pests.
By participating in genetic testing and selective breeding programs, beekeepers can improve their chances of obtaining high-quality queenright stock. This not only enhances the overall health and productivity of their colonies but also contributes to the long-term sustainability of their apiaries.

How Often Should I Replace My Queen?
The frequency of queen replacement depends on various factors, including the colony’s age, size, and overall health. Typically, beekeepers replace their queens every 2-3 years or when a queen’s performance begins to decline significantly. Regular inspections will help you determine if it’s time for a new queen.
